#dd1851 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d1851 is composed of 86.7% red, 9.4%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.1% magenta, 63.3%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 342.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 48%. #dd1851 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30a2 with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#dd1851 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d1851 has RGB values of R:221, G:24,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.63,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14489681.

Shades and Tints of #dd1851
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090103 is the darkest color, while #fef6f8 is the lightest one.
